                        <guid>https://hamiltonpolice.on.ca/news/updated-infor-2019-flamborough-fatal/</guid><pp:caseid>392252</pp:caseid><description><![CDATA[<p>A fatal collision in the early morning hours of June 9, 2019, took the life of a 21-year-old Lynden man has been concluded. The single motor vehicle collision took place in the area of Woodhill Road and Concession 4 West in Flamborough.</p>

<p>The initial stages of the investigation found the man did not sustain a physical injury from the impact but died by electrocution after exiting his vehicle from&nbsp;down power hydro lines due to the&nbsp;collision. Reports recently received concluded speed, impairment as well as distracted driving were all contributing factors in this collision.</p>

<p>Hamilton Police would like to remind everyone to be extremely cautious near unknown downed wires. If you see a damaged or hanging powerlines, maintain a minimum distance of 10 meters and report it to the local utility services. If in a vehicle and an overhead power line drops on top of the vehicle, stay inside and call 9-1-1.</p>
